In India, unfortunately prejudice has taken deep roots in the form of an obsession with fair skin, especially with regards to women. Pinky Beauty Parlour is an engaging, entertaining, and a poignant tale of the repercussions this obsession for fairer skin has on a human mind, families and society in general. It is a touching journey of two sisters lives, Pinky and Bulbul, who run a beauty parlor in the by-lanes of Banaras, the holiest of cities in India. The story starts one morning as a dead body is found hanging in the beauty parlor. Police Inspector Jata Shankar and the somewhat slow Constable Sami Akhtar, starts the investigation in their own quirky ways, we enter a unique colorful world of a beauty parlor, and are drawn into a complex and engaging story of inter-mingled loyalties and insecurities.
